What is the best airport to fly to in Bristol?
Keep your eyes peeled for an affordable fare to Tri-Cities Regional Airport (TRI). It’s the city’s main airport and is located around 15 miles southwest of the downtown area. After walking out of the arrivals area, it won’t be long before you’re enjoying the very best of Bristol.

How long is a flight to Bristol?
The United States is big, so that depends on your point of departure. To make things simple, we’ve chosen three of the most common routes to Bristol and calculated their average flight times:

  • Atlanta, GA (ATL-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ta Intl.) to Tri-Cities Regional Airport (TRI) - 1 hour and 5 minutes
  • Charlotte, NC (CLT-Charlotte-Douglas Intl.) to Tri-Cities Regional Airport (TRI) - 1 hour and 6 minutes
  • Dallas, TX (DFW-Dallas-Fort Worth Intl.) to Tri-Cities Regional Airport (TRI) - 2 hours and 16 minutes

What is the cheapest day of the week to fly to Bristol?
Look into leaving early in the week for cheap flights to Bristol. Orbitz data from 2020 suggests Monday is typically the most inexpensive day to start your trip, followed by Tuesday. Saturdays were shown to have the highest airfares. This is possibly because most passengers prefer to kick off their getaway on a weekend.
What is the cheapest month to fly to Bristol?
According to Orbitz data, you should fly out in August. This is generally an excellent month to score cheap flights to Bristol. Be aware that the most expensive time to jet off is during the month of June.

How many direct flights are there to Bristol?
Each month, there are 26 flights that go directly to Bristol. Airlines that fly nonstop to this destination include American Airlines, Delta Air Lines and Allegiant Air.
